Brewton-Parker Christian University is a private nonprofit institution in Mount Vernon, Georgia enrolling 774 students, according to the U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ard's 2024-25 release. The acceptance rate is 96.5%. Graduates earn a median of $42,009 ten years after enrollment, based on U.S. Treasury tax records linked to federal financial aid data. The average net price after financial aid is $26,054. Institution-level records in the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) classify each school by Carnegie category, ownership sector, and urban/rural locale, which is how this profile's peer group and cost cohort are determined; Brewton-Parker Christian University is categorized as "Baccalaureate Colleges: Diverse Fields" under the Carnegie classification system, a meaningful signal when comparing like-to-like institutions.

Admissions and cost figures below come from the same annual IPEDS Fall enrollment survey and net-price calculation that every Title IV institution is legally required to submit to the federal government, so the same standardized methodology applies whether comparing a public flagship or a small private college. Net price nets grant and scholarship aid out of the published sticker price, the number financial-aid experts consider the honest comparison point - the table further down breaks that figure out by family income band rather than a single blended average, since what one family actually pays can look very different from what another family pays at the identical school.

The outcomes further down come from federal tax records the U.S. Treasury links to former students who received federal financial aid, not a self-reported alumni survey - an approach that removes response bias but also means graduates who never took federal aid are absent from the earnings figures. Completion and retention rates only count first-time, full-time degree-seeking students, so a school with a large transfer or part-time population can serve those students well without that showing up in these particular metrics. Reading the cost, completion, and earnings figures together, rather than any single one in isolation, is the approach the College Scorecard's own methodology recommends for judging return on investment.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the acceptance rate at Brewton-Parker Christian University?
Brewton-Parker Christian University is a private nonprofit institution in Mount Vernon, Georgia. The acceptance rate is 96.5%. Total enrollment is 774 students.
How much do Brewton-Parker Christian University graduates earn?
Graduates of Brewton-Parker Christian University earn a median of $42,009 ten years after enrollment. Six years after enrollment, median earnings are $35,732.
How much does Brewton-Parker Christian University cost?
The average net price at Brewton-Parker Christian University is $26,054. In-state tuition is $20,120 and out-of-state tuition is $20,120. Median student debt at graduation is $24,990.
What is the graduation rate at Brewton-Parker Christian University?
Brewton-Parker Christian University has a 4-year completion rate of 22.2%. The first-year retention rate is 48.4%.
Is Brewton-Parker Christian University worth the student debt?
The median student debt at Brewton-Parker Christian University is $24,990, while graduates earn a median of $42,009 ten years after enrollment. That debt represents about 59% of first-year post-graduation earnings. Among borrowers who completed their program, 60.6% are repaying their loans within 3 years. Estimated monthly loan payment is $265.
